Why Couples Prefer Jaipur for a Destination Wedding
Jaipur’s appeal lies in its rare combination of history, architecture, and cultural richness. A wedding here isn’t just an event—it feels like a curated cultural celebration.
1. Royal Architecture Everywhere
Massive gateways, sandstone fortresses, Mughal-style gardens, marble courtyards, and intricate carvings create a cinematic backdrop for ceremonies. Even modern venues in the city incorporate heritage design elements.
2. Seamless Destination Connectivity
Jaipur is well-connected by air, rail, and road, making it easy for guests traveling from anywhere in India or internationally.
3. Rich Rajasthani Traditions
Cultural elements like folk music, traditional décor, and ceremonial rituals bring authenticity and emotional depth to the wedding experience.
4. Versatile Venue Options
From intimate heritage properties to grand palaces capable of hosting hundreds of guests, Jaipur offers a wide range of settings for every kind of celebration.
